"FOUR BEDROOM GEORGIAN HOUSE WITH SEPARATE TWO BEDROOM BARN CONVERSION. Enjoying A Fine Rural Position With Extensive Views Over Open Farmland Towards The Mendip Hills This Fine South Facing Georgian Detached Former Farmhouse Is Situated In Delightful Gardens And Grounds Extending To Almost 3 Acres. The Grounds Also Provide An Extremely Well Appointed Detached Stone Barn Conversion, The Old Barn, Which Is Completely Self-Contained And Is Eminently Suitable For Dependent Relatives. Other Uses Of This Versatile Accommodation Might Include Holiday Letting and Working From Home. Many Rooms Of Both Farmhouse And Old Barn enjoy pleasing double aspects YEW TREE FARM Ground Floor: Entrance Porch - Reception Hall - Drawing Room - Music Room - Separate Dining Room - Utility Room With Cloakroom Large Farmhouse Kitchen - Conservatory. First Floor: Master Bedroom Suite With Dressing Area And Good Sized En-Suite Shower Room - Guest Bedroom With En-Suite Bathroom And Shower - Double Bedroom Three - Single Bedroom Four - Family Bathroom - Small Study/Computer Room. THE OLD BARN Reception Hall - Cloakroom - Sitting Room With Fireplace - Separate Dining Room - Kitchen With Utility Area - Ground Floor Bedroom With En-Suite Shower Room. First Floor: Bedroom With En-Suite Bathroom. EXTERIOR The attractive formal gardens and grounds amount to nearly 3 acres. The grounds to Yew Tree Farm are arranged with formal garden and duck pond to the front and continue around the property with the partly walled south facing formal garden, a large and productive fruit and vegetable garden, orchard and paddock of approximately 1 acres. There is a fine range of outbuildings including garage, large store and workshop, stone fronted fuel store and other storage, and versatile stabling accommodation, gated and opening onto the paddock. Entry to The Old Barn is by a private gated and walled courtyard garden and it has its own separate self-contained lawned, bordered and hedged garden, with mature apple trees, to the rear. DESCRIPTION Yew Tree Farm represents a rare opportunity to acquire a most attractive period country home which also provides a detached self contained barn conversion eminently suitable for dependent relatives, and for a variety of other purposes including family or even holiday lettings. The gardens and grounds that surround the property are an absolute delight, extremely well tended, stocked and comprise formal gardens, vegetable garden, orchard, paddock of approximately 1 acres in all amounting to just under 3 acres. The property itself is well appointed throughout and the accommodation is well proportioned and flexible and comprises: reception hall, three reception rooms, conservatory off of the large family sized kitchen and utility room. To the first floor are four bedrooms, two en-suites, family bathroom and small study/computer room. The Old Barn is a charming property in its own right with much character built in natural local stone and providing accommodation of two separate reception room, kitchen with utility area, cloakroom, two bedrooms both en-suite and having its own completely enclosed and self contained garden. Both properties retain many period features with open fireplaces, shuttered sash windows and have delightful views south and east over open farmland towards the Mendip Hills. Many of the rooms have dual aspects and the property, although enjoying this rural situation, is far from cut off as the A370 is only some 5 minutes drive away and the M5 under two miles away. LOCATION Rolstone is a small hamlet which lies to the south and west of the City of Bristol and is surrounded by delightful open rural scenery with the Mendip Hills, an area designated as being of outstanding natural beauty, only a short drive away. Convenient to the A370 the village has, for many years, enjoyed a popular reputation for those wishing to commute to the City of Bristol and further afield having good access to motorway connections as well as Bristol Airport which is some 20 minutes away. In the nearby communities of Weston-super-Mare, Winscombe and Worle there are a wide range of shops and facilities on hand. Schooling, in both the private and State sectors, is well provided for in the area. Primary schools at nearby Hewish and Banwell and secondary schooling at Backwell School and Churchill Community School, which has an adjoining leisure centre open to the general public, are among those available in the State sector. For the active sporting, social and recreational facilities abound within the area which include a number of clubs, societies and sports clubs. Glorious country walking is available nearby on the Mendip Hills and the Bristol Channel coastline is only a few minutes drive away at Weston Super Mare or Woodspring Priory. There is premier trout fishing on Chew Valley and Blagdon Lakes and a variety of challenging local golf courses and sailing on Chew Valley Lake and Axbridge Reservoir. SERVICES Mains electricity and water are connected to the properties. Private drainage. Independent oil fired central heating systems to both properties.
